Habitat. Canines are native to all continents except Antarctica and Australia, where dingos were introduced by humans. The smallest canine is the Fennec fox, which weighs about 3 pounds.



What is the smallest member of the canine department?

According to the University of Edinburgh, the smallest canine is the fennec fox. It measures only 9.4 inches (24 centimeters) and weighs only 2.2 pounds. (1 kilogram). The largest canine is the gray wolf, 6.5 feet (200 cm) high and 3-5 feet (1-1.5 meters) long. 27th. 2017

Is a fox a kind of dog?

Dogs, also known as canines, include foxes, wolves, jackals, and other members of canine dentistry (canidae). They are found all over the world and tend to be slender, long-legged animals with long muzzles, bushy tails, and upright pointed ears.

Are foxes close to dogs or cats?

Foxes are related to dogs, but behave like cats. Red foxes are a member of the canine family along with dogs, but they have something in common with cats.
